TL;DR
TOTO
TOTO is widely regarded as the gold standard for bidet toilet seats. The TOTO Washlet series, particularly the S550e and S7A models, are frequently recommended for their luxury features like instant warm water, high-speed drying, and auto open lid [1:8]
[2:1]. Users have praised TOTO for its durability and reliable customer support, although some older remote controls had issues
[4:3]. For those seeking the ultimate experience, the TOTO Neorest NX2 integrated toilet offers self-cleaning features but comes at a steep price
[5:4].
Brondell
Brondell is another popular brand with several models that cater to different budgets. The Brondell Swash 1400 and LE99 are noted for their comfort and ease of installation [2]
[3]. Users appreciate the value Brondell offers, especially when purchased from retailers like Costco
[4:1]. While not considered luxury, Brondell bidets are praised for their functionality and reliability
[4:6].
BioBidet
BioBidet has mixed reviews. While some users initially liked models like the BB-2000 Bliss, others reported issues such as remote malfunctions and seat misalignment [2:3]. Additionally, there are concerns about longevity, with some units failing shortly after warranty periods
[1:9]. Despite these issues, BioBidet remains a popular choice due to its feature-rich offerings.
Affordable Alternatives
For those on a budget, the Philtre bidet attachment offers similar features to Brondell at a lower price [1:5]. The Eco-NOVA bidet seat is also recommended for its sleek design and robust warranty
[3:2]. These options provide essential features like adjustable water pressure and heated seats without breaking the bank.
Considerations Beyond the Discussions
When selecting a bidet toilet seat, consider key features such as heated seats, warm water, and electric versus non-electric models. It's important to ensure compatibility with your toilet bowl type (round or elongated) [4:4]. If you're looking for a premium experience, investing in a higher-end model like the TOTO Neorest might be worthwhile, but for everyday use, brands like Brondell and affordable alternatives offer great value.

I can only speak from my own personal experience but I have a Toto skirted Nexus toilet with the Toto S7 washlet and I love the combo. I purposely did not get an integrated toilet/bidet - reasoning being that if the washlet ever had a problem, it could be sent out for repair/replacement without having to remove a whole toilet.
I also did not want the automatic open/close lid because it’s a very small bathroom and I didn’t need it opening every time I walked past the doorway - but I have all the ‘bells and whistles’ otherwise. I am crazy about this thing and miss it when I travel.
Just as an FYI, only the top portion of the Neorest would be sent in for factory repair.. or if you are in one of many service areas, Toto does provide in home service for their Neorest and Washlet.
Toto s550. Toto k300 is basically s550 without auto close/open lid. S550 is nicer but the auto lid eventually fails in time. I’m on my third 550e and have 2 k300s in guest bathrooms. Note, drunk visitors will sit on the auto lid before it has a chance to open if your bathroom is small.

You will see a lot of comments on here that the basic, sub $100 ones work just fine. And they do! However..... there is something to be said for the higher end models, as well. I have a Toto (can't remember the model) that is fully customizable per user - Water temperature, pressure, position. And also has a dryer feature and a charcoal filter to cut down on the stink. It is also self cleaning, and removes from the toilet with one touch of a button for easy cleaning of the toilet and the underside of the bidet. My wife and I find that we have very different preferences so the customizability is incredibly helpful for us. And, quite frankly, our asses deserve it.
There is also the consideration that the more complicated ones with electronics in them are more prone to failure. A friend of mine got one of those but it died after a few years, and he then replaced it with a cheap one that is simpler and thus more reliable. If buy it for life is your goal, you'll be better off with a basic one without electronic controls.

Key Considerations for Bidet Toilet Seat Brands:
Features: Look for features such as adjustable water temperature, pressure control, heated seats, and air dryers. Some models also offer night lights and self-cleaning nozzles.
Ease of Installation: Choose a brand that offers easy installation, ideally with a DIY option. Most bidet seats can be installed in under an hour.
User-Friendly Controls: Consider models with intuitive controls, whether they are remote-controlled or have side panels. User-friendly interfaces enhance the overall experience.
Build Quality and Warranty: Opt for brands known for durability and quality materials. A good warranty (at least 1-3 years) is also a sign of a reliable product.
Price Range: Bidet seats can vary widely in price. Determine your budget and look for brands that offer good value for the features you want.
Top Brands to Consider:
TOTO: Known for high-quality products, TOTO bidet seats (like the TOTO Washlet series) offer advanced features and excellent performance.
Bio Bidet: Offers a range of models with great features at competitive prices. The Bio Bidet BB-2000 is highly rated for its performance and comfort.
Kohler: Known for stylish designs and reliable performance, Kohler bidet seats often come with innovative features and a solid warranty.
Brondell: Offers a variety of models that balance affordability and functionality. The Brondell Swash series is popular for its user-friendly features.
Alpha: A newer brand that has gained popularity for its high-quality bidet seats at a more affordable price point. The Alpha JX is a well-reviewed model.
Recommendation: If you're looking for a top-tier option, the TOTO Washlet C100 is highly regarded for its performance and features. For a more budget-friendly choice, consider the Bio Bidet BB-2000, which offers excellent functionality without breaking the bank.
